Transaction

95a539f7101e9ef3fe2820c5d5d27ddaf26f9d9e99d4cf081be70dcdaaefc4f2
445,058 confirmations
Timestamp
1510690104
Block494,374
Fee94,900 sats
Fee rate365 sats/vB
view on mempool.space

Inputs & Outputs